Hello everyone!

Are you all excited about tomorrow? We will be re-releasing some of our past PSP titles to celebrate the launch of the PSPgo! And what’s really awesome about this is that our past PSP titles will be 50% off for the whole week! The discount will only be valid for one week starting tomorrow, so don’t miss this chance to get our past titles on your PSP!

Here is the list of discounted titles. The price range is between $4.99 and $9.99! (Correction: $4.99 – $14.99)

Speaking of “Holy Invasion of Privacy, Badman! What Did I Do to Deserve This?”, we are still thinking about making a UMD for the game. However, we would like to know if there will be enough demand for us to create the UMD version. So I would like to use this opportunity to ask you all if you would like to see a UMD release of Holy Invasion of Privacy, Badman! We appreciate your participation! We are hosting this poll on the NIS America official website as well.

[poll id=”18″]

NIS America announced two new titles during the NISA luncheon meeting at TGS. We will release Atelier Rorona on PlayStation 3 and Holy Invasion of Privacy, Badman! 2 on PSP in 2010! When we have more information for each title I will visit here again and share them with you all!

Lastly, NIS America released the promotional movie for Sakura Wars: So Long, My Love last week. If you haven’t had a chance to check it out, here it is! This is a promotional trailer, and doesn’t have much game play footage in it, but we are currently working on getting a game play trailer up for you!
